Not only was it poorly operated, it was a terrible concept to begin with. The people running the place tried to combine "therapy" (which was a joke) with military discipline. When I was there, since I had admitted to trying alcohol (I could have counted the number of times on one hand, at that point), I was put into Alcoholics Anonymous, and told that I could not say the word "only," because this was "minimizing my behavior." Graduating from this group treatment was one of the conditions of me leaving.
All of the "therapists" on staff were poorly educated graduate students with a cookie-cutter mentality about the children they were working with (I wasn't "ghetto" either, so they were completely clueless as to what to do with me).
The staff members were, for the most part, either ex-military or reservists, with little to no training on how to deal with an "escalating" teenage girl.(Hint: Push-ups will not make me a more productive citizen). I absolutely agree that they were also under-paid and under-trained, not to mention under-equipped.
There were only two types of people who worked there (and, indeed, at ANY juvenile facility); People who genuinely wanted to help troubled children, and people who were on a power-trip. Sadly, there were not enough of the former, and most of them quit within a matter of months.
The last I had heard when I left Ladoga was that all the girls from my county were being pulled out and placed somewhere else, since the brochures/program directors/whoever had lied about what was being offered at the facility (They still do... Look up their website). I am shocked to see that it lasted this long (but not in the least surprised to see that there was a riot there two years ago). Goodbye, Ladoga, and good riddance!
